ExxonMobil sues Dutch government over gas field closure
US petroleum giant ExxonMobil has invoked the controversial Energy Charter Treaty in a potential multi-billion euro compensation claim – an apparent bid to pressure the Netherlands’ new right-wing government over the shuttering of Europe’s largest gas field in Groningen.
